Chelsea boss, Graham Potter believes his team will get better after the Blues’ 1-1 draw against Salzburg at Stamford Bridge on Wednesday.

The result leaves Chelsea with an uphill task of qualifying for the Champions League knockout stages as they face AC Milan in a doubleheader.

Reacting to the draw, Potter told BT Sports that he’s impressed with the performance of the players.

“We’re disappointed with the result. I thought the boys gave everything. We scored a good goal but lost a bit in the second half but their goalkeeper made some good saves.

“It is what it is, we have to dust ourselves down. Personality and application were good, we will get better. We got Raheem in one-on-one situations quite often and the goal was a good result of that.

“It’s always irritating when you concede a goal. Overall the defensive performance was quite good, it’s just the little details we will have to improve.

“It has not been easy for the boys, they have responded to us really well over the last few days and it’s a point we will have to take and get better. The attitude has been fantastic, no complaints apart from the fact we have not taken three points.”
